that makes no sense conceptually. once something is in the repo, it will
stay there forever. and the default wallpaper changes at least once per
release. so by doing a history cut now, you'd only postpone the problem,
and create a royal mess on the way.
shallow clones (whenever they may come) should fix the history bloat
problem for local clones, so there isn't a really strong reason
long-term to externalize the multimedia data.
i'm not against such a "carve out" (i'm even slightly pro, especially
short-term), but it would have to be done properly.
